There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Lubbock is 21.7% cheaper than New Braunfels. With a cost index of 83 vs 105,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Lubbock to New Braunfels should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Lubbock is $1,137/month compared to $1,536/month in New Braunfels — a 26%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Lubbock is more affordable at $197,900 median vs $315,100.

Median household income in Lubbock is $60,487 compared to $88,257 in New Braunfels (-31.5%). While New Braunfels is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Lubbock spend roughly 22.6% of their income on rent, more than the 20.9% in New Braunfels.

Climate-wise, New Braunfels is notably warmer with an average of 69.6°F compared to 61.4°F in Lubbock. New Braunfels receives more rainfall at 31.3" per year compared to 18.3" in Lubbock.
